正在加载中...

关闭
请选择需要拨打的号码
关闭
请根据问题类型选择QQ咨询

已解决:阿里云服务器怎样将Nginx注册为系统服务,实现开机自启动?

已解决:阿里云服务器怎样将Nginx注册为系统服务,实现开机自启动?

阿里云服务器怎样将Nginx注册为系统服务,实现开机自启动?为什么要注册为服务呢?因为作为服务,就会自动启动,方便远程维护,所以很多时候都需要将memcached、nginx、tomcat等都注册为系统服务,就算宕机也不怕。那么怎么将中间件注册为服务呢?

  首先,安装好Nginx,然后这里需要用到一个小程序,下载一个 Windows Service Wrapper(winsw.exe)

  打开winsw-service包解压,将两个文件移动到Nginx根目录;

   

 

  然后打开 winsw-service.xml,修改配置参数(Nginx的实际安装路径)

   

 

  cmd命令进入Nginx根目录,输入命令 winsw-service.exe install 将Nginx注册成为系统服务。

   

 

  Win+R 输入命令 services.msc,找到Nginx Service服务,双击将启动类型设置为 ” 自动 ”,然后启动。可以看到任务管理器中 nginx已经启动。

   

 

  如若需要卸载服务,需先将服务停止,再卸载,进入Nginx目录输入命令,winsw-service.exe stop(停止服务),winsw-service.exe uninstall(卸载服务)

   

 



返回上一页